Based in London, Smriti Vicari is active in Egon Zehnder’s Financial Services Practice. Drawing on her industry experience, she focuses on partnering with clients to resolve critical leadership challenges, transforming organisations and enabling talent to thrive.

Leadership talent is the heart and soul of every organisation. I’m passionate about working with clients to unlock their potential and pave the way for them to achieve their goals.

Prior to joining Egon Zehnder, Smriti worked at Visa Europe, where she successfully led the Strategy and Corporate Development team, served as Chief of Staff to the European CEO, and built up the FinTech & Strategic Partnerships division. Before that she gained experience in the financial services industry at global institutions including State Street Bank and Moody’s Investors Service.

Smriti earned a BSc in finance from the University of Southern California and an MBA from London Business School. Besides English, she has a conversational command of Italian.
